What Is Addiction Counseling in Atlanta?

Addiction Counseling in Atlanta is a therapeutic service designed to help individuals understand addictive behaviors, identify triggers, and develop healthier coping mechanisms. Rather than focusing only on stopping the behavior, therapy works to uncover the emotional, psychological, and environmental factors contributing to addiction.

Addiction can affect people differently, but it often involves repeated patterns that feel difficult to break despite negative consequences. Counseling helps individuals build awareness, strengthen decision-making, and develop strategies that support long-term recovery.

Our Addiction Counseling Process

  1. Initial Consultation

The first session focuses on understanding your situation, history, and goals for recovery.

  1. Identifying Triggers and Patterns

Therapy explores emotional triggers, habits, and environmental factors that contribute to addictive behavior.

  1. Developing Coping Strategies

You will learn practical tools to manage cravings, reduce stress, and replace unhealthy behaviors.

  1. Strengthening Emotional Control

Sessions focus on improving emotional awareness and building resilience against relapse.

  1. Building Long-Term Recovery Habits

Progress is reviewed regularly to ensure lasting change and continued personal growth.

This structured process helps individuals feel supported and confident throughout their recovery journey.
